Nexperia China Declares Independence, Restores Output After Dutch Block

Nexperia China’s production and delivery capabilities are recovering after its operational split from Dutch parent Nexperia, Wingtech Technology Chairperson Yang Mu said on May 29, 2026, signaling stabilization following a 2025 Dutch government intervention to prevent a China shift. Speaking in Shanghai, Yang told the China Star Market that Nexperia China’s independent operational structure has largely been established, with core management and R&D teams fully authorized over business decisions. The unit severed ties with Nexperia Europe, which halted wafer shipments to China, prompting it to forge alliances with multiple Chinese suppliers. A stable multi-node, multi-source supply model is now formally implemented, Yang said, underscoring the unit’s resilience. Wingtech (Shanghai: 600745), the Chinese owner of Nexperia, has acknowledged its control over the Dutch chipmaker remains restricted following the October 2025 Dutch decree that blocked the transfer of chip operations to China.
